Mechanism of Action

OMNICEF PLUS TAB contains cefdinir, a third-generation cephalosporin antibiotic, and azithromycin, a macrolide antibiotic. Cefdinir exerts its antibacterial effect by inhibiting bacterial cell wall synthesis, leading to cell lysis and death. It is effective against a wide range of Gram-positive and Gram-negative bacteria. Azithromycin, on the other hand, inhibits bacterial protein synthesis by binding to the 50S ribosomal subunit, thereby preventing the growth and replication of bacteria. The combination of these two antibiotics allows for a broader spectrum of activity and can be particularly effective in treating polymicrobial infections.

Pharmacological Properties

OMNICEF PLUS TAB is characterized by its pharmacokinetic properties, which include good oral bioavailability and a favorable half-life that allows for once-daily dosing. Cefdinir is well absorbed from the gastrointestinal tract, with peak plasma concentrations occurring approximately 2 to 4 hours after administration. It has a volume of distribution that indicates extensive tissue penetration, particularly in respiratory tissues. Azithromycin also demonstrates good tissue penetration, especially in macrophages, which enhances its effectiveness in treating intracellular pathogens. Both components are primarily excreted via the kidneys, necessitating caution in patients with renal impairment.

Interactions

OMNICEF PLUS TAB may interact with other medications, which can affect its efficacy or increase the risk of adverse effects. Antacids containing aluminum or magnesium may reduce the absorption of cefdinir, and it is advisable to separate the administration of these medications by at least two hours. Additionally, azithromycin may interact with drugs that prolong the QT interval, increasing the risk of arrhythmias. Patients should inform their healthcare provider of all medications, supplements, and herbal products they are taking to avoid potential interactions.
